Sewer Backup Water Removal Cost in Royse City, TX

The cost of sewer backup water removal can vary greatly dep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Royse City, TX. These estimates are based on real-world costs and can vary depending on your specific situation.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, type of flooring, and amount of water extracted.
Drying and Disinfection $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of materials, and amount of disinfection required.
Repair and Reconstruction $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, type of materials, and complexity of repairs.
